Cod with almond dill crust

Directions
-
Extra needed: food processor and low oven dish.
-
Make sure the cod fillets are at room temperature.
-
Preheat the oven to 200 ° C.
-
Grease the oven dish.
-
Grate and squeeze the lemon.
-
Cut the bread into pieces.
-
Chop the dill coarse.
-
Rub the cod fillets with some lemon juice, salt and freshly ground pepper.
-
Leave them for 5 minutes.
-
Grind the almonds with the bread in the food processor fine and crumbly.
-
Mix the turmeric, mustard, dill, lemon zest, salt, pepper and olive oil.
-
Place the pieces of cod fillet in the baking dish and spread the almond dill mixture over it.
-
Press something.
-
Put the dish in the oven and bake the cod in 20 minutes until golden brown and done.
